Metropolitan Police Will Deploy Drones for 999 Emergency Responses

The Metropolitan Police are launching a new trial programme deploying remote drones from buildings across London to respond to 999 calls. The drones are outfitted with high-definition cameras and travel autonomously to incident locations, where they transmit a live video feed to police personnel for immediate intelligence. The initiative aims to help locate missing people, trace suspects, and provide aerial views during major incidents. The pilot began in Islington, with plans to expand to the West End and Hyde Park by year-end.
